Oracle10g双机热备配置文档Oracle10g双机配置文档一、目的:用DellPowerVaultMD3000模块化磁盘存储阵列做为双机的存储单元。实现两台DellPowerEdgeR710在Windonws2003sev下的双机热备和oracle10g数据库的双机热备。全部18(服务器各4块,存储阵列柜10块块硬盘做做RAID5),做为DellPowerEdgeR710的存储单元部分。二、环境:1、主机:2台DellPowerEdgeR710服务器2、系统:Windowssrv2003R2SP23、HBA:2块4、网卡:每台服务器使用2块网卡。5、盘柜:DellPowerVaultMD3000模块化磁盘存储阵列三、准备:1、两台DellPowerEdgeR710用一条网线(交叉线)直连,作为心跳线。两块相对应的网卡IP为:192.168.0.1和192.168.0.2(根据具体环境设置)。2、两台DellPowerEdgeR710分别接一条网线到交换机。3、HBA从存储与服务器相连。4、此实验相关参数。节点1(主服务器)节点2(从服务器)服务器名DELL-ADELL-B本地连接10.0.0.110.0.0.2本地连接子网掩码255.255.255.0255.255.255.0心跳IP10.68.1.1010.68.1.11心跳子网掩码255.255.255.0255.255.255.0集群虚拟IP10.0.0.100集群虚拟名dtrl域名rl.comOracle数据库名orcl仲裁盘E盘Oracle10g双机热备配置文档四、拓扑图这是一个两节点群集,每台服务器使用两块网卡,一块作为内部连接,用于服务器之间的心跳线和数据镜像传输;一块连接到外部网上。五、安装Windowsserver2003和oracle10g(1)在每一节点上安装WindowsServer2003R2SP2中文企业版。(2)安装网络:每个群集节点至少要求两个网卡-一个与公用网络连接,另一个与只与包含群集节点的专用网络连接。专用网络适配器建立节点对节点的通讯、群集状态信号和群集管理。每个节点的公用网络适配器都将群集与客户机所在的公用网络连接。验证所有的网络连接是否正确,专用网络适配器只与其它专用网络适配器连接,而公用网络适配器与公用网络连接。注意网线不要接错。(3)安装磁盘(4)安装活动目录(ActiveDirectory)群集中的所有节点必须是同一域的成员,并能访问域控制器和DNS服务器。可以将它们配置为成员服务器或域控制器。如果您决定将一个节点配置为域控制器,那么您应该将同一域中的所有其它节点都配置为域控制器。此次把两个节点配置为域控制器。注意事项:如果域中没有DNS服务器,在安装活动目录时,使用第一个节点服务器作为DNS服务器,那么在安装第二台服务器的活动目录之前,在配置网卡的ip时,将DNS配置为第一台服务器的IP地址,这样,安装第二台服务器的活动目录,就可以做出正确的域名解析。(5)oracle10g注意事项,数据库程序安装在本地磁盘,全局数据库存放在磁盘阵列中。Oracle10g双机热备配置文档六、配置简要步骤:1、在主服务器上建立主域控制器。2、在备服务器上建立额外域控以及配置DNS。3、MD3000集群(cluster)配置,即配置从、磁盘阵列柜。4、oracle10G双机配置(安装数据库,建立数据库,创建监听服务并在群集中添加数据库服务以及数据库监听服务)。Oracle10g双机热备配置文档双机热备文档二(上)之建立主域控制器1、打开第一台服务器,单击开始,从“管理工具”中选择“管理您的服务器”项。2、进入服务器管理界面后,选择“添加或删除服务器角色”。Oracle10g双机热备配置文档3、确认要求后,单击“下一步”。4、会出现以下画面,耐心等待。Oracle10g双机热备配置文档5、出现以下画面,选择“自定义配置”。6、选择“域控制器(ActiveDirectory)”。Oracle10g双机热备配置文档7、进入配置向导界面,单击下一步。8、进入使用ActiveDirectory安装向导,单击下一步。Oracle10g双机热备配置文档9、操作系统兼容性,单击下一步。10、域控制类型,选择默认的“新域的域控制器”,单击下一步。Oracle10g双机热备配置文档11、选择默认的“在新林的域”,单击下一步。12、输入“新域的DNS全名”,单击下一步。Oracle10g双机热备配置文档13、域的NetBIOS名,默认即可,单击下一步。14、数据库文件夹,日志文件夹存放位置默认即可,也可自行更改,单击下一步。Oracle10g双机热备配置文档15、sysvol文件夹位置默认即可,单击下一步。16、选择将“这台服务器设为这台计算机的首选DNS服务器”,单击下一步。Oracle10g双机热备配置文档17、操作系统兼容权限,选择只与Windows2000或windowsserver2003,单击下一步。18、设置“还原模式密码”,单击下一步。Oracle10g双机热备配置文档19、出现以下画面,耐心等待。20、完成ActiveDirectory安装向导,单击完成。Oracle10g双机热备配置文档21、提示是否重启计算机,单击立即“立即重新启动”。22、重启之后提示此画面,此时第一台服务器域控制器配置完成。Oracle10g双机热备配置文档双机热备二(下)之额外域控以及DNS配置1、打开开始,管理工具,选择“管理您的服务器”。2、选择“添加或删除角色”。Oracle10g双机热备配置文档3、单击“下一步”。4、出现以下画面,耐心等待。Oracle10g双机热备配置文档5、选择“自定义配置”。6、选择“域控制器(ActiveDirectory)”Oracle10g双机热备配置文档7、单击“下一步”。8、进入欢迎使用ActiveDirectory,单击“下一步”。Oracle10g双机热备配置文档9、进入操作系统兼容性,单击“下一步”。10、输入用户名(若使用手动创建的用户,此用户必须具有Administrator的所有权限),密码,域名(此处的域名为主控制域的域名)。单击“下一步”。Oracle10g双机热备配置文档11、指定额外控制域成为那个域控制器的域名。单击“下一步”。12、单击“下一步”。Oracle10g双机热备配置文档13、单击“下一步”。14、创建还原模式密码,单击“下一步”。Oracle10g双机热备配置文档15、单击“立即重新启动”。16、开机后显示,此服务器现在是域控制器。Oracle10g双机热备配置文档在额外控制域上建立DNS服务器。1、单击开始,管理工具,单击“管理您的服务器”。2、选择“添加或删除角色”。Oracle10g双机热备配置文档3、单击“下一步”。4、选择“DNS服务器”,单击“下一步”。Oracle10g双机热备配置文档5、单击“下一步”。6、此时要求插入系统盘,进入此画面,单击“下一步”。Oracle10g双机热备配置文档7、单击“下一步”。8、选择“只配置跟提示”,单击“下一步”。Oracle10g双机热备配置文档9、单击“完成”。10、单击“确定“。Oracle10g双机热备配置文档11、单击开始,管理工具,DNS,右键单击DNS,选择连接到DNS服务器,选择下列计算机,输入另一台DNS计算机名称。(DELL-A输入DELL-B,DELL-B输入DELL-A)。此时可以再任意一台服务器上查看对端的DNS服务器状态。Oracle10g双机热备配置文档第一章MD3000软件安装配置向导(这里仅以DELLMD3000举例,不同存储设备将有所区别)一:安装前的准备1、环境描述:操作系统:Windows2003Server数据库:oracle10g服务器1:DellPowerEdgeR710服务器2:DellPowerEdgeR710磁盘阵列:DELLMD3000(146G硬盘*10)HBA卡:SAS5/E二、机群模式中磁盘阵列与服务器连接的方式MD3000上一般有两个In接口,和一个Out接口。接主机一般使用两个In接口,In口与主机的SAS5E口相连接。三、连接盘柜将磁盘阵列与服务器所在的交换机相连,右键“本地连接”,选择“tcp/ip”属性,在点击“高级”,选择“DNS”,单击“添加”,添加ip地址192.168.128.101192.168.128.102子网掩码255.255.255.0,这2个地址为SAS5/E默认连接地址。Oracle10g双机热备配置文档四、安装SAS5E驱动程序1、如果您还没有安装SAS5/E的驱动程序,这里先要进行SAS5/E驱动程序的安装2、使用DellSAS5/E驱动程序安装向导,安装驱动。Oracle10g双机热备配置文档3、DELL软件许可协议。4、选择适配器设备的驱动程序。Oracle10g双机热备配置文档5、选择安装,安装向导将自动完成SAS5/E的驱动程序安装。6、安装完成。按照此步骤驱动另一条服务器SAS5/E端口。Oracle10g双机热备配置文档五、MD3000配置管理软件安装1、安装MD3000存储软件2、语言选择,软件支持中文和英文。Oracle10g双机热备配置文档3、安装管理和监视存储所需要的软件、工具等。4、DELL软件许可协议,选择接受。下一步。Oracle10g双机热备配置文档5、如没有特殊要求,这里使用默认路径安装程序。6、选择典型安装,下一步。Oracle10g双机热备配置文档7、DELL软件安装描述。Oracle10g双机热备配置文档8、完成安装并按照提示重新启动系统。Oracle10g双机热备配置文档第二章MD3000RAID配置方法一、配置主机访问。做这一步的同时,最好是单机联结MD3000,特别是多SAS卡的时候,为防止主机访问SASID造成的混乱,最好在此开一台主机,首先配置主机组(点击创建主机组按照提示配置)。在配置主机访问。如下图,在配置中选择配置主机访问选项,手动配置主机访问。如下图:Oracle10g双机热备配置文档接下来打开下一个页面如下图:此处选择Windows2000/Server2003Clustered此选项支持2003群集。接下来指定HBA主机端口,将已知的HBA主机端口添加到所选HBA主机端口标识符中,(本次配置中共2块BHA卡,每台服务器各一快)。Oracle10g双机热备配置文档单机下一步,配置访问组如下图。在红色标记下,可以输入你需要主机组名,如“abc”。当然如果你已经有了主机访问组,也可以直接选取,如下图:单击下一步完成主机访问组的设置Oracle10g双机热备配置文档。说明:无论是双机还是多机,此处都需要定义一下访问组,所有集群中的服务器如需要共享同一个存储区的话,都应该在这个组中二、创建RAID回到“设置”页面,选“创建虚拟磁盘”如下图。进入配置界面后,选择“未配置的容量:创建新的磁盘组和虚拟磁盘”如下图Oracle10g双机热备配置文档选择下一步这一步选择“手动配置”单击下一步,选择要做的RAID级别,及使用多少块硬盘创建RAID。本例中我们选择10块硬盘,创建一个RAID5,如下图:Oracle10g双机热备配置文档选择添加,把硬盘移到右边,单击“计算容量”,此时会显示你要做的RAID的容量大小,当容量显示后,单击下一步,确认要创建的RAID。下图是RAID的主要参数设置,包括RAID的大小,再给你要做的RAID取一个名字,当然也可以使用系统给的名字“1”。“I/O特性”处,根据你的应用情况,选择阵列存取的段大小,对于文件系统,段越大,存取速度越快,而对于数据库,则不能选择太大,因为数据库的文件包一般较小。如下图所示Oracle10g双机热备配置文档单击下一步,创建主机映射,创建了这一步,服务器才可以访问到你的磁盘阵列。如下图所示。RAID创建完成后,如果不需要再创建其它的RAID,此处选“否”,退出配置Oracle10g双机热备配置文档然后打开系统磁盘管理器,选择“重新扫描硬